1998 mazda b4000 high mount light doesn't work. where is fuse located? not shown on manual.

Mazda B4000 high mount light fuse location


User
1998 mazda b4000 high mount light doesn't work. where is fuse located? not shown on manual.

ChatGPT
The high mount brake light fuse on a 1998 Mazda B4000 may not be shown in the owner's manual because it is often a shared circuit with other lights and accessories.

That being said, the fuse for the high mount brake light is typically located in the engine compartment fuse box or under the dashboard fuse box. Check your owner's manual for the exact location of the fuse box in your vehicle.

Once you locate the fuse box, look for a fuse labeled "STOP" or "CHMSL" (Center High Mount Stop Lamp) or "BRAKE" that is related to the high mount brake light. Use a fuse puller or needle-nose pliers to remove the fuse and check if it has blown.

If the fuse is blown, replace it with a new fuse of the same amperage rating. If the new fuse also blows, there may be an underlying issue with the wiring or the high mount brakelight assembly itself that will require further investigation by a qualified mechanic.

2004 mazda rx8 won't start crankshaft sensor

no engine told. 1.3L R2?,, ROTARY ENGINE "Wankel." twin rotor. 4 spark lugs. leading and following sure. post the DTC codes. only do not tell the techs what they mean sure p0302 sure. but what was the other code P0335???? ESS???? or 336? yes spark plugs are always replaced as a set , $2.50 plugs are cheap, learn that P0302 does not mean only spark it means weak combustion energy on #2 only bad/low compression. #2 rotor. bad spark#2 (oops no cure) new HV spark wires not routed wrong. 19 year old spark wires HV are no good now. bad injections #2 rotor. (as 2 injectors, #2 bad /weak or partially clogged or leaking. the CKP sensor on many car, can not just be thrown on. some call for shims, others spacer pads or must be put in to learn /calibrate mode. now I will read the SM to you, service manual RX8, r2 can't be thrown ON, the CKP
  1. Remove the right side driveshaft.
  2. Remove the cylinder block lower blind plug and install the special service tool or equivalent.
  3. Turn the crankshaft pulley to the clockwise until it stops.
  4. Using a straight edge, draw a straight line directly in the center of the ninth tooth of the crankshaft pulley pulse wheel (counting counterclockwise from the empty space).NOTE If the line is not accurately drawn, ignition timing, fuel injection and other engine control systems will be adversely affected. Drawn the straight line carefully using a straight edge.
  5. Align the centerline of the crankshaft position sensor and the line drawn, then install the sensor.
  6. Install the CKP sensor fitting bolts. Tightening torque 4.1-5.5 ft lbs
  7. Remove the special service tool or equivalent then install the cylinder block lower blind plug. Tightening torque 15 ft lbs
  8. Install the right side driveshaft.
  9. Install the splash shield.
  10. Install the right front wheel
amazing facts, . DOne wrong the Sensor is destroyed. How to replace heater core in the Mazda B2200

After you remove the hoses from the core, remove the nuts and bolts that secure the heater case to the firewall in the engine bay. Inside the cab you will have to remove the glove box assembly for clearance. then disconnect the blower fan wiring. there may be another bolt securing the heater case to the firewall on the inside of the cab. Then you should be able to remove the heater case. You'll have to split the heater case to get to the core.

1999 Mazda 626 2.0 5 speed. It stutters at idle when the a/c compressor kicks in while in defrost or a/c, smooths out when it isn't. Changed the a/c relay to no avail.

Question edited for clarity. Left your duplicate text to show difference. :>) Question moved to model category. Site scripts will drop you into the correct category if written my way. The AC takes a lot of power from the engine. Slip the belt off and see how freely the compressor turns. It should have some resistance, but not enough to slow the engine which also is trying to turn the alternator. There is also the possibility that your battery is failing, or the connections are not good starving the engine management of volts and amps..
